Introducing Your MN Boys Runner of the Year Candidates


Hamza Mohamed
Wayzata High School

---

Wayzata's Hamza Mohamed led the Wayzata boys back to Team Nationals for the first time since 2017 (note the 2021 meet was canceled, Wayzata qualified) and also led them to their 2nd straight Class AAA state title in Minnesota. He was their #1 runner for every meet after the St. Olaf High School Showcase and helped them finish the season with five straight meet wins after the Roy Griak. 

Mohamed set a new personal best time of 15:17.30 at the Team Heartland Regional where he finished 20th overall and helped Wayzata to their 8th Heartland title and 9th Team Nationals berth overall. 

Aside from leading the Wayzata boys to success this season, Mohamed is now one of the fastest runners in Wayzata's storied history. He ranks as the 5th fastest Wayzata runner ever for the 5K, only behind three former state XC champions and a runner-up finisher in Andrew Brandt.

Mohamed will still lead the Wayzata boys at the Team Nationals on 12/3 where he will look to cement his legacy as a Wayzata runner.
